12 Days of Christmas - Day 2
This full bodied handmade, originally made in Cuba by Karl and Antonio Cuesta, was brought back to the American marketplace back in 1964 by master blender Frank Llaneza for exclusive sale in the shops of Alfred Dunhill. Thankfully, at the end of the Cigar Boom years, as Dunhill exited the retail tobacco business, the brand was released for commercial distribution.
Packed un-cellophaned in cedar slide cabinets of 25 that are ideal for long term storage, these cigars are as close as humanly possible to re-creating the vintage cigars that came from Havana in the 1950's.
